According to the online real estate company, buyers in the South of ...Renting also tends to have lower upfront costs compared to buying a home. Rather than coming up with a large down payment to secure a mortgage, renters usually only need to provide a security deposit and first month’s rent. This can be a more affordable option for those who may not have a significant amount of savings.1. You may be able to build equity. Because a lease is considered a legal contract, a tenant must be at least 18 to rent a house. futures trading chat roomshjen etf The annual unrecoverable cost of owning a home is about 5% of the property value (whether you have a mortgage or not). If your rent is lower than that for a comparable home, you should keep renting. If your rent is higher than that, you’re probably better off buying a comparable home.
